What people are actually afraid of
Almost nobody has been dumped for using software. The fear sitting behind this question is older and more specific than that. It is walking into a bar and watching a small recalculation happen on somebody's face, the one that means you are not the person in the pictures. Everything after that is polite.
And that failure predates AI by about two decades of online dating. It is the photo from four years and one haircut ago. It is the one from before your body changed. It is the one processed until the face in it is a narrower, smoother version of the face that turns up. It is the group photo picked because it happened to catch the one angle you like of yourself. Not one of those was generated. Every one of them produces the exact moment you are worried about.
So the question is the wrong one
The useful question is not "will they notice it was AI". It is "is this a current likeness of me". Make that substitution and most of the confusion clears, because the second question has an answer you can check, and you are the only person in the world who can check it.
It also explains why a photo can be entirely real and still fail, and why a generated image can be accurate and pass without incident. The method is not what is being tested.
What actually gives a generated image away
The specific question still deserves a specific answer, so here is one. Failures cluster in the places where a model has to invent structure rather than reproduce it.
- Hands and fingers. Count, length, and the way a hand meets an object it is supposed to be holding.
- Teeth. Too many, too even, or with boundaries between them that do not resolve when you actually look.
- Jewellery and watch faces. A watch is a small dense object with rules. Numerals out of order, hands that do not meet at the centre, a ring that changes width as it passes behind a finger.
- Text. Writing on clothing, signs, book spines, labels. It comes out letter-shaped rather than as words.
- Glasses. Frames that merge into the skin, arms that never arrive at the ear, lenses that fail to shift what is behind them.
- Ears. Shape that drifts between images, earrings attached to nothing, an ear that dissolves into hair.
- Hair against a busy background. Individual strands are where the boundary between a person and a scene tends to break down.
- Repeated patterns in fabric. Stripes and checks that go out of register across a fold or a seam.
- Backgrounds that do not survive a second look. Fine at a glance, then a chair with the wrong number of legs, a doorway that leads nowhere, a reflection of something that is not present.
- Skin that is too even. No pores, no texture, none of the small asymmetries every real face has.
Then the one that is not about any single image. A set of six with the same light, the same distance, the same expression and the same tilt of the head reads as synthetic even when no individual picture has a flaw in it. Real photos of one person are inconsistent, because life is. This is the tell most people fail, and it is the one a better generator does not fix.
What does not give it away
The fact of generation, by itself. There is no visible property shared by all generated images that a human being can see. When somebody says they can always tell, what they mean is that they can tell when it is bad, which is a much smaller claim and a true one.
Nor does somebody simply knowing. A person who knows an image was generated and can see that it looks like you does not have a problem to solve. What creates the problem is a gap between the image and you, not the software that produced it. That list has a shelf life
Every item above has been described as an unsolvable problem and then stopped being one. Hands were the famous tell for two years and largely are not now. Text is improving. Skin texture is improving. A list of tells is a snapshot of what current models happen to be bad at, and reading it in a year will feel like reading a phone review from 2019. Treat it as dated the day it was written, because it is.
That cuts in an uncomfortable direction. As the tells disappear, the only thing left holding an image honest is whether it is true.

What has to be true for the answer to be no
- It is you. Your face, your bone structure, your body, your age. Not a quietly corrected version that would need explaining.
- It is you now. Current weight, current hair, glasses if you wear glasses, beard if you have one. A genuine photograph of you from 2019 is not a current likeness either, which is the point.
- You would be relaxed if they knew how it was made. Not delighted, not eager to raise it, just relaxed. If the honest answer is that you would rather they never found out, the image is doing work the rest of you cannot support in person.
If any of the three is false, a better generator does not fix it and you should not buy one, ours included. What fixes it is a current photo, however ordinary. An ordinary accurate picture beats a spectacular inaccurate one at the only moment that counts, which is the moment you walk in and they look up.
